Transaction dfc8999c854250152105d9c3fb6fbf1f65ec784fcc4d244c59517e15ff6d2438
1 Input
1 Output
-
dfc8999c854250152105d9c3fb6fbf1f65ec784fcc4d244c59517e15ff6d2438:0
- value
- 9913435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09664f5f02eaf94cfa9ad8ca0774a607538383ed OP_EQUAL
- address
- 32YiZtxfMWAMZDyXD31woLRfVwMALq2r71